What Defines an AI App Builder or Cloud IDE in 2026?

Modern platforms go beyond simple code suggestion tools. They integrate:

  • Natural language-to-code conversion
  • Real-time debugging and optimization
  • Automated infrastructure provisioning
  • Integrated DevOps workflows
  • Collaborative cloud-based environments

The most effective tools act as intelligent development partners rather than passive editors.

1. GitHub Copilot Workspace

GitHub Copilot Workspace has evolved into a comprehensive AI-native development environment. It allows developers to describe features in plain English, automatically generating structured project plans, codebases, and deployment pipelines.

Key features include:

  • Conversational project scaffolding
  • Integrated GitHub Actions automation
  • Real-time vulnerability detection
  • Multi-language support

Its deep integration with GitHub repositories makes it ideal for professional teams managing large-scale projects.

2. Replit AI Studio

Replit AI Studio has positioned itself as one of the most accessible cloud IDEs available. With zero local setup required, users can build full-stack applications directly in the browser.

Its AI assistant supports:

  • Instant app prototyping
  • One-click backend provisioning
  • Automated database setup
  • Collaborative multiplayer coding

Entrepreneurs and indie developers favor it for rapid MVP creation.

3. Bubble AI Builder

Bubble has integrated powerful AI tools into its no-code ecosystem. In 2026, users can describe entire workflows and UI layouts verbally, with the system generating responsive applications automatically.

It stands out for:

  • Visual drag-and-drop editing enhanced by AI suggestions
  • Smart workflow automation
  • API integration generation
  • Scalable hosting infrastructure

This platform appeals particularly to non-technical founders seeking production-grade applications.

4. AWS CodeCatalyst AI

Amazon’s AWS CodeCatalyst AI combines cloud infrastructure management with AI-driven coding assistance. It bridges development and deployment within the AWS ecosystem.

Core strengths:

  • Automated environment provisioning
  • Intelligent CI/CD pipeline generation
  • Security best practice enforcement
  • Deep integration with AWS services

Enterprises already operating within AWS benefit most from its built-in optimization tools.

5. Google Project IDX AI

Google’s Project IDX AI has matured into a scalable cloud development workspace powered by Gemini AI models. It supports full-stack development with an emphasis on web and mobile applications.

Its AI capabilities include:

  • Context-aware code completion
  • Intelligent bug fixes
  • Framework-specific optimizations
  • Android and web deployment pipelines

The platform’s integration with Google Cloud allows automatic scaling and monitoring, reducing operational burdens.

6. Cursor AI Cloud IDE

Cursor AI has expanded from being a smart code editor to a robust cloud IDE. Its standout feature is deep contextual understanding of entire codebases, enabling meaningful architectural suggestions rather than surface-level edits.

Developers value it for:

  • Comprehensive refactoring support
  • Automatically generated documentation
  • Cross-file reasoning and debugging
  • Secure collaborative workspaces

It is particularly effective for complex, long-term projects requiring consistent architectural integrity.

7. Microsoft DevBox AI

Microsoft’s DevBox AI integrates seamlessly into the Azure ecosystem. It offers cloud-hosted development environments with enterprise-grade compliance and governance.

Features include:

  • Natural language infrastructure setup
  • AI-guided performance tuning
  • Azure-native security controls
  • Seamless GitHub and Azure DevOps integration

It provides an excellent solution for corporations requiring strict security standards and scalable cloud resources.

8. Lovable AI App Builder

Lovable AI App Builder has emerged as a favorite among startups. It focuses on fast front-end creation paired with automatic backend logic generation.

Key highlights:

  • Instant UI generation from prompts
  • Real-time editing with AI refinement
  • Built-in authentication systems
  • Rapid deployment to multiple cloud providers

Its simplicity combined with advanced customization makes it attractive for rapid product iteration.

Key Factors When Choosing an AI App Builder

While the technology is impressive, selecting the right platform requires consideration of:

  • Project complexity: No-code builders suit simple apps, while enterprises may need advanced cloud IDEs.
  • Scalability: Infrastructure capabilities vary significantly.
  • Security and compliance: Critical for regulated industries.
  • Collaboration needs: Teams require real-time editing and access control.
  • Cost structure: Subscription and usage-based pricing models differ widely.

Organizations should evaluate both short-term speed and long-term maintainability before committing to a platform.

Frequently Asked Questions (FAQ)

  • 1. What is the difference between an AI app builder and a cloud IDE?
    An AI app builder often emphasizes no-code or low-code development with automated workflows, while a cloud IDE is a fully featured development environment hosted in the cloud with integrated AI coding assistance.

  • 2. Are AI app builders suitable for enterprise-level applications?
    Yes, many platforms now support scalable infrastructure, security compliance, and advanced customization, making them viable for enterprise use when chosen carefully.

  • 3. Do developers still need to know how to code?
    While AI reduces the need for manual coding, understanding programming concepts remains important for debugging, customization, and architectural decisions.

  • 4. How secure are AI cloud IDEs?
    Leading platforms offer enterprise-grade security, including encryption, role-based access control, and compliance certifications. However, security levels vary by provider.

  • 5. Can AI-generated code be trusted for production environments?
    AI-generated code is increasingly reliable, but best practices recommend human review, testing, and validation before deployment to production systems.
